This is some of what I learned from the Nancy Boren workshop I attended:  find the mystery in the subject, once you establish the center of interest you can destroy the rest, and it is important to find the hard edge and soften the rest.  This was my most successful painting of the workshop. We had a lovely model who was willing to pose anyway we wanted.  She set up outside under a blue umbrella.  It was fabulous to paint with such talented artists.

If you think this looks a lot like the painting I posted yesterday, you would be right!  This is a larger version I did as a demo for a class.  I also did two of these for a (dated) challenge for Daily Paintworks to do two paintings that are the same but different.  This one I painted in acrylic first very quickly to lay down the local colors, then I applied oil alla prima.  Which one do you like better?  I haven't decided what I am going to do with this painting yet.
